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in New Richmond

Planning ahead for your dumpster rental in New Richmond will make your project easier and safer to finish on time. When renting a dumpster in New Richmond, follow these tips to help you plan ahead.

1. Clear an area that is large enough for the dumpster to sit for a number of days or weeks. Also, be sure that you and other people have access to the dumpster. You must have a clear path that prevents accidents.

2. Prepare the things you would like to remove. In the event you're c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for example, try and remove as much of the damaged materials before the dumpster arrives.

3. Get any permits you might want. If your plan is to depart the dumpster on a public road, then you certainly might want permission from the city.

4. Have your security gear prepared. This consists of gloves, rear supports, and other items which you will need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.

Paying for your dumpster

If you would like to rent a dumpster in New Richmond, you will find that prices vary greatly from state to state and city to city. One method to get actual quotes for the service you need would be to phone a local dumpster business and ask regarding their prices. You may also request a quote online on some websites. These websites may also contain complete online service that is constantly open. On these websites, you can choose, schedule and pay for your service whenever it's suitable for you.

Variables which affect the cost of the container contain landfill fees (higher in some areas than others) as well as the size of the container you choose. You have to also consider transport costs as well as the kind of debris you will be putting into your container.

Price quotes for dumpster rental in New Richmond generally contain the following: the size of the container, the kind of debris involved, the base cost for the dumpster, how much weight is contained in the estimate, a specified rental period and delivery and pickup fees.


Some Things That You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ster

Although the specific rules that regulate what you can and cannot contain in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of materials that most dumpster rental service in New Richmonds WOn't let. Some of the things which you normally cannot place in the dumpster contain:

Batteries, especially the type that include m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other chemicals that can damage the environment) Electronics, especially the ones that contain batteries There are additionally some mattresses you could usually place in your dumpster provided that you're willing to pay an added f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it's best to contact your rental business to get a list of stuff which you can not put into the dumpster.

Front-load vs Roll-off Dumpsters

Front -load and roll off dumpsters have distinct designs which make them useful in different ways. Knowing more about them will enable you to select an alternative that's right for your project.

Front-load Dumpsters

Front-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that may lift heavy items. It is a handy option for projects that comprise a lot of heavy things like appliances and concrete. They're also great for emptying commercial dumpsters like the kind restaurants use.

Roll-off Dumpsters

Roll-off dumpsters are typically the right option for commercial and residential projects like repairing a roof, remodeling a basement, or adding a room to your house. They've doors that swing open, letting you walk into the dumpster. Additionally they have open tops that let you throw debris into the container. Rental companies will usually leave a roll off dumpster at your project location for a number of days or weeks. It is a handy option for both little and big projects.

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in New Richmond

When you rent a dumpster in New Richmond, you're d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you probably do not use these terms every single day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can really enable you to cope with company workers who may get impatient if you don't realize what they are explaining about their products.

"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the big met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often let in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to include the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you could say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in New Richmond?

Residential clean outs generally don't need big dumpsters. The size that you simply require, though, will depend on the size of the undertaking.

Should you plan to clean out the whole house, then you probably need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You could likewise use this size for a big cellar or loft clean out.

In case you just need to clean out a room or two, then you may want to choose a 10-yard dumpster.

When choosing a dumpster, though, it's frequently a good idea to request a size bigger than what you believe you'll need. Unless you are a professional, it's tough to estimate the exact size needed for your project. By getting a somewhat bigger size, you spend a little more money, however you also prevent the possibility that you will run out of room. Renting a bigger dumpster is nearly always cheaper than renting two small ones.
